To receive medical services at Physicians Immediate Care, veteran patients can reserve a time online at PhysiciansImmediateCare.com or simply walk into any of our 40+ locations for same-day care. Upon arrival, the patient should tell the front desk that they are a veteran. At the end of their visit, we will bill the VA through a third party administrator for all services provided.
To be eligible, veterans must be enrolled in the VA health care system. In addition, they must have received care through the VA or from a VA community provider within the past 24 months.
